About the Role
The Operations Technical Lead will drive the technical direction for services and integrations within the operations domain, ensuring seamless operation of internal systems and third-party platforms to support business order and fulfillment. This role involves translating business needs into technical solutions, championing engineering standards, and identifying continuous improvement opportunities.
Responsibilities
- Providing hands-on technical advice, code reviews and practical guidance to the team
- Managing a team of developers and quality engineers, including setting goals and priorities, providing technical guidance and mentorship, and conducting performance evaluations.
- Proactively driving continuous improvement to team performance and outcome quality.
- Ensuring solutions meet all necessary business requirements, architectural principles and applicable security and technical standards.
- Maintaining effective technical documentation.
- Owning the team’s technical backlog and working closely with the Product Owner to champion technical work during planning sessions.
- Participating in the development of system features or supporting automation, as required.
- Promote best practices, support cross-team alignment, and contribute to the technical community.
Requirements
- Strong practical experience working with commerce systems, leading engineering teams, and experience in software development, with a focus on cloud technologies.
- Proven experience integrating third-party services and platforms.
- End-to-end SDLC experience with solid architectural design knowledge.
- Experience in building scalable and secure cloud-based applications and infrastructure using AWS technologies, including Lambda, SQS, API Gateway and Dynamo DB.
- A keen awareness of architectural design patterns including eventing and microservices.
- Experience designing and integrating REST and GraphQL APIs, including webhooks and OAuth.
- A track record of leading and delivering complex initiatives involving multiple systems and partners.
